Course Content

• Trade Strategy Analysis Fundamentals
• Technical Analysis for Trade Strategy Development (including chart patterns, indicators)
• Fundamental Analysis for Trade Strategy Development (macroeconomic factors, company financials)
• Risk Management in Trade Strategies (position sizing, stop-loss orders)
• Backtesting and Optimization of Trade Strategies
• Algorithmic Trading and Automated Trade Strategies
• Portfolio Construction and Management for Trading
• Market microstructure and its impact on trade execution
• Performance Measurement and Evaluation of Trading Strategies

Career path

Career Role Description
Senior Trade Strategy Analyst Develops and implements complex trade strategies, leveraging advanced analytical techniques and market intelligence. Leads teams and mentors junior analysts. High demand for expertise in international trade and regulations.
Trade Strategy Consultant (International Trade) Provides expert advice on trade strategy to clients across various sectors. Strong analytical and communication skills are crucial, along with deep understanding of global trade policies and agreements.
Quantitative Trade Analyst Uses quantitative methods and statistical modeling to analyze trade data and identify profitable opportunities. Requires strong programming skills and expertise in econometrics. High growth area in the UK trade sector.
Trade Risk Analyst Assesses and mitigates trade risks, ensuring compliance with regulations and minimizing financial losses. Strong understanding of international trade law and risk management techniques is essential.
